The reason why planets in the outer solar system have more moons than those in the inner solar system is primarily that there was more debris around the outer planets when they were forming. The correct answer is option b.

During the early stages of the solar system's formation, a process known as accretion occurred. This process involved the gradual accumulation of gas and dust particles in a protoplanetary disk surrounding the young Sun. As the particles collided and merged together, they formed larger bodies, including planets and moons.

The outer solar system, which includes gas giants like Jupiter and Saturn, had a greater abundance of debris in their vicinity. This increased availability of material allowed for the formation of more moons. The greater amount of debris provided more opportunities for collisions and accretion to take place, resulting in the formation of numerous moons around the outer planets.

While the solar wind and the capturing of moons by the outer planets (c) can also play a role in the number of moons, they are not the primary reasons for the disparity. The weaker solar wind (a) in the outer solar system may have allowed for a higher retention of captured moons, but it is not the main driver of moon formation. Therefore, the correct choice is b. there was more debris around the outer planets when they were forming.

Option A, According to the Mount Pinatubo particulate model, the fine debris and sulfur dioxide that was first released into the atmosphere moved from East to West.

One of the biggest volcanic explosions of the 20th century was the Mount Pinatubo outburst in 1991. The explosion significantly altered the climate of the entire planet by releasing millions of tons of ash and sulfur dioxide into the sky.

According to the eruption's particle model, the easterly trade winds were what caused the erupted material's original atmospheric movement, which was from east to west. The material was ultimately spread to higher altitudes by the dominant westerlies, which led to a drop in world temps and a rise in atmospheric aerosols.
